将数据从 rest api 推送到 sql 数据库的最佳方法是啥?

Posted

技术标签:

【中文标题】将数据从 rest api 推送到 sql 数据库的最佳方法是啥?【英文标题】:What is the best way to push data from a rest api to an sql database?将数据从 rest api 推送到 sql 数据库的最佳方法是什么? 【发布时间】:2020-04-07 05:36:44 【问题描述】:

我有 2 个其他 API,第一个将返回一个 id,我可以使用它从第二个获取更多数据。我想将第二个 api 的结果推送到我在 phpMyAdmin 中的 sql 数据库中。做这个的最好方式是什么?我应该用另一种编程语言编写脚本吗?我计划推送至少一百个结果。

【问题讨论】:

【参考方案1】:

您使用什么语言与其他 API 进行交互?假设它是某种服务器端语言,例如 PHP,那么您将在 PHP 中创建一个数据库连接(查找 PDO、mysqli),然后您可以编写一个 MySQL 命令,例如 INSERT INTO 将您的数据写入MySQL 数据库。

PHPMyAdmin 没有任何作用,除了它为您提供基于 Web 的数据库管理以手动执行操作(例如查看、写入、修改等)。

【讨论】:

所以我查找了语法并设法编写了一个执行此操作的 php 脚本。感谢您的建议。

以上是关于将数据从 rest api 推送到 sql 数据库的最佳方法是啥?的主要内容,如果未能解决你的问题,请参考以下文章

将新数据从 Node REST API 推送到 React-Native

将数据从 Sql Server 推送到桌面应用程序

使用 ADO.NET 将数据表从内存推送到 SQL Server

如何将数据从本地 SQL Server 推送到 AWS 上的 Tableau Server

计划的 SQL Server 实例推送到 Azure SQL 数据库

如何将 Spark 结构化流数据写入 REST API?